Output 653d33dde309f17d2559fcec1fbec712483bd1329e609e08abe990932ca31e95:2

value
89000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 117fdf2917bfa128ec773555e113cfcef333f5fe OP_EQUAL
address
33HYbVFBDx5CD6VYTnV8dzWKAgHmfwqZJ3
transaction
653d33dde309f17d2559fcec1fbec712483bd1329e609e08abe990932ca31e95
confirmations
172054
spent
true